The Joint Video Team (JVT) of ISO/IEC MPEG and ITU-T VCEG are finalising a new standard for the coding (compression) of natural video images. The new standard [1] will be known as H.264 and also MPEG-4 Part 10, “Advanced Video Coding”. The standard specifies two types of entropy coding: Context-based Adaptive Binary Arithmetic Coding (CABAC) and Variable-Length Coding (VLC). This document provides a short introduction to CABAC. Familiarity with the concept of Arithmetic Coding is assumed.

Universal Serial Bus (USB) is a communications architecture that gives a personal computer (PC) the ability to interconnect a variety of devices using a simple four- wire cable. The USB is actually a two-wire serial communication link that runs at either 1.5 or 12 megabits per second (mbs). USB protocols can configure devices at startup or when they are plugged in at run time. These devices are broken into various device classes. Each device class defines the common behavior and protocols for devices that serve similar functions. Some examples of USB device classes are shown in the following table

An AHB system is made of masters slaves and interconnections. A general approach to include all possible "muxed" implementation of multi layered AHB systems and arbitrated AHB ones can be thought as an acyclic graph where every source node is a master, every destination node is a slave and every internal node is an arbiter there must be one and only one arc exiting a master and one or more entering a slave (single slave verus multi-slave or arbitrated slave) an arbiter can have as many input and output connections as needed. A bridge is a special node that collapses one or more slave nodes and a master node in a new "complex" node.

Using the UnderC Tokenizer Class It s often necessary to parse complex text files, where standard i/o is too clumsy. C programmers fall back on strtok(), but this can be tricky to use properly. Besides, you are still responsible for keeping strtok() fed with new input, and I don t like the schlepp. Tokenizer is a text-parsing input stream, modelled after the (undocumented) VCL TParser class, and based on the UnderC tokenizing preprocessor front-end.
